九月范文网 > 报告 > 实验报告
sql语言的ddl实验报告范文7篇 word A4格式

sql语言的ddl实验报告范文

sql语言的ddl实验报告范文怎么写?下面我们九月范文网实验报告频道给大家精编的7篇关于sql语言的ddl实验报告范文,希望对大家有所帮助,内容仅供参考!

sql语言的ddl实验报告范文篇1

近年来,随着信息技术的迅速发展,数据库管理系统在各个领域中得到了广泛的应用。SQL作为结构化查询语言,是数据库管理系统中重要的一部分,而DDL(Data Definition Language)则是SQL语言的数据定义部分,用于定义数据库的结构。本实验报告旨在通过对SQL语言DDL的实验操作,探讨其基本语法、功能以及应用。

实验目的

1. 了解SQL语言中DDL的基本概念和作用。

2. 掌握SQL语言中DDL的基本语法和使用方法。

3. 实践利用SQL语言进行数据库的创建、修改和删除等操作。

实验环境与工具

实验中我们将使用MySQL数据库管理系统进行操作,通过MySQL Workbench工具进行SQL语句编写和执行。

实验内容与步骤

1. 创建数据库

首先,我们将通过SQL语言的DDL语句来创建一个新的数据库。在MySQL中,可以使用如下语句:

```sql

CREATE DATABASE mydatabase;

```

上述语句表示创建一个名为“mydatabase”的数据库。

2. 创建数据表

接下来,我们将在已创建的数据库中创建一个数据表。使用如下语句:

```sql

USE mydatabase;

CREATE TABLE users (

id INT AUTO_INCREMENT PRIMARY KEY,

username VARCHAR(50) NOT NULL,

email VARCHAR(100) NOT NULL

);

```

上述语句表示在“mydatabase”数据库中创建名为“users”的数据表,该数据表包括id、username和email三个字段,并指定id字段为自增主键。

3. 修改数据表结构

在实际应用中,经常需要对已存在的数据表进行结构调整。我们可以使用SQL语言的DDL语句来实现这一目的。例如,添加一个新的字段:

```sql

ALTER TABLE users

ADD COLUMN age INT;

```

上述语句表示向“users”数据表中添加一个名为“age”的整数类型字段。

4. 删除数据表

当不再需要某个数据表时,可以使用SQL语言来删除该数据表。例如:

```sql

DROP TABLE users;

```

上述语句表示删除“users”数据表。

实验总结

通过本次实验,我们对SQL语言的DDL有了更深入的了解。DDL作为SQL语言的重要组成部分,通过其功能强大的数据定义语句,能够方便地完成数据库和数据表的创建、修改和删除等操作。掌握DDL的基本语法和使用方法,对于进行数据库管理和开发工作具有重要意义。

在实际应用中,我们需要根据具体的业务需求,灵活运用DDL语句来管理数据库结构,保证数据库的稳定性和高效性。同时,也需要注意DDL操作可能带来的风险,谨慎对待数据库结构的变更,确保数据安全和可靠性。

综上所述,SQL语言的DDL在数据库管理和开发中起着至关重要的作用,通过不断实践和学习,我们能够更好地利用DDL语句来完成各种数据库操作,从而提升工作效率和数据管理质量。

以上就是本次SQL语言的DDL实验报告的内容,希望对读者有所帮助。

sql语言的ddl实验报告范文篇2

1、熟练掌握if、if…else、if…elseif语句和witch语句格式及使用方法,掌握if语句中的嵌套关系和匹配原则,利用if语句和switch语句实现分支选择结构。

2、熟练掌握while语句、do…while语句和for语句格式及使用方法,掌握三种循环控制语句的循环过程以及循环结构的嵌套,利用循环语句实现循环结构。

3、掌握简单、常用的算法,并在编程过程中体验各种算法的编程技巧。进一步学习调试程序,掌握语法错误和逻辑错误的检查方法。

sql语言的ddl实验报告范文篇3

1、实验前:预习实验内容,学习相关知识。

2、实验中:按照实验内容要求进行实验,实验时注意每种SQL语句的基本命令及各个关键字的含义,做好实验记录。

3、实验后:分析实验结果,总结实验知识,得出结论,按格式写出实验报告。

4、在整个实验过程中,要独立思考、独立按时完成实验任务,不懂的要虚心向教师或同学请教。

5、要求按指定格式书写实验报告,且报告中应反映出本对次实验的总结,下次实验前交实验报告。

sql语言的ddl实验报告范文篇4

计算并输出1000以内最大的10个素数以及它们的和。

要求:

在程序内部加必要的注释。

由于偶数不是素数,可以不考虑对偶数的处理。

虽然在1000以内的素数超过10个,但是要对1000以内不够10个素数的情况进行处理。

输出形式为:素数1+素数2+素数3+…+素数10=总和值。

算法描述流程图

main函数:

判断素数:

源程序

#include

#include

intsushu(intn)/*判断素数的函数*/

{

intt,i;

t=sqrt(n);

for(i=2;i<=t;i++)

if(n%i==0)/*如果不是素数,返回0*/

return0;

returnn;/*如果是素数,返回该数*/

}

voidmain

{

inti,j=0,n,m=0,a[1000],x;

/*clrscr;*/

printf("pleaseinputanumberform1to1000:");

scanf("%d",&x);

if(x==2)/*x=2时的处理*/

printf("%dn",x);

elseif(x<=1)/*x在1~1000范围外时的处理*/

printf("error!n");

else

{

if(x%2==0)/*x为偶数时,把x变为奇数*/

x--;

for(i=x;i>1;i-=2)/*x为奇数时,做函数计算*/

{

n=sushu(i);/*做判断素数的函数调用*/

if(n!=0)/*对素数的处理*/

{

a[j]=n;/*把素数由大至小存入数组a[]中*/

j++;

if(j<11)

m+=n;/*统计前10个素数之和*/

}

}

if(j<10)/*当素数个数小于10个时,结果输出*/

{

for(i=0;i

{

n=a[i];

printf("%d",n);

printf("+");

}

printf("2=");

printf("%dn",m+2);

}

elsefor(i=0;i<10;i++)/*当素数个数大于等于10个时,结果输出*/

{

n=a[i];

printf("%d",n);

if(i<9)

printf("+");

else

{

printf("=");

printf("%dn",m);

}

}

}

}

测试数据

分别输入1000、100、10测试。

sql语言的ddl实验报告范文篇5

当素数个数小于10时的处理不够完善,考虑不够周全。把“+2”的处理做的太勉强。

程序过大,不够精简,无用文字太多。

学习耐心与细心不足,如scanf(“%d”,&n);中的“&”经常忘记。

编程思想不够发散,例如如何判断素数,只能想出2种方式(其中1种为参考教科书上内容);在今后学习中应更多的动脑,综合运用所学。

基本功不够,如清屏clrscr等函数用的不好,有时同样的问题多次犯,给实验课老师带来很大的麻烦。这说明我的知识不够广,有很多有用但不做考试要求的书中内容没有学好,认识程度不够深刻。就算以后c语言这门课程结束后,也应多看相关东西,多上机练习,才能真正从本质上提高自己。

物理实验报告·化学实验报告·生物实验报告·实验报告格式·实验报告模板

知识不够广泛,如vc++6.0等程序,自己试了好一阵也不会用;说明我电脑水平还是不够,自学能力不够。已会的东西掌握的还是不够好。

sql语言的ddl实验报告范文篇6

SQL(StructuredQueryLanguage)语言是关系数据库的标准语言。是一种介于关系代数与关系演算之间的结构化查询语言,其功能并不仅仅是查询,SQL语言是一个通用的、功能极强的关系数据库语言。

本次实验了解SQL语言中DDL语言的CREATE、DROP、ALTER对表、索引、视图的操作,掌握在NavicatforMySQL中用DDL语言进行对表、索引、视图的增加、删除和改动。掌握使用SQL语句增加或删除约束,加深对完整性概念的理解,达到灵活应用的目的。掌握使用SQL语

句定义和删除同义词。

sql语言的ddl实验报告范文篇7

1、问题的提出现在中学英语教学最大的弊病就是学生缺少言语技能。为了改善学生的交际能力,我们提出了“提高学生英言语技能”的研究课题。为此我们在高中各年级进行了长达四年的课题研究,积累了一定的经验。

2、课题研究的目标和主要内容课题组根据英语教学大纲的要求,培养学生在口头上运用英语进行交际的能力,提高观察、注意、记忆、想象、联想等能力。主要内容是训练学生能对所学文章进行概括、转换、补充、评价及推断。概括就是在学习预习课文的基础上,要求他们认真领会文章中心思想或主要内容,经过思考,用三五句话加以概括总结。转换就是充分发挥学生模仿性强的特点,用所学知识来改变局部课文的写法,重新组织文字进行表达的一种训练方式。学生由模仿到创造,举一反三,融会贯通,有利于求异思维的培养,达到知识迁移的目的,提高口头交际的能力。补充就是特定语言环境扩展联想,进而由学生对原文进行补充的训练形式。先给学生一定的语言环境,然后启发学生的发散思维、想象能力,对理解记忆中的表象进行加工改造以后,得到一种新的形象思维。评价是一种更高层次的思维训练、言语训练。它要求学生必须加深对文章中心思想的理解,抓住文章中主人公的心理活动,鉴赏并挖掘课文的真正思想,在此基础上利用英语来表达自己对文章主题或主人公性格特点的评价与认识。推断是培养学生用英语进行推断讲述,也是很必要的。通过推断进行假设,培养他们逻辑揄和想象能力。最后能够达到脱口而出的水平。

3、课题研究的理论根据

(1)言语是人们交流思想时的话语,由引可以以为言语能力就是交际能力。言语能力能够把语言知识和言语知识灵活又得体应用于语言交际。言语能力以语言能力为基础。但语言能力并不能“自然”地转化为言语能力。要具有言语能力还必须具有言语知识或交际规约和语言国情知识,必须接触大量的语篇形式的教材,必须进行反复言语操练。语言能力通过课文教学得到提高,言语能力通过课文教学得以发展。示意图

(2)“说”是一个复杂的心理活动,这个过程是将自己内化的语言材料进行编码,即借助于词语按一定的句式,连贯地转换外部有声语言。“说”得有说的动机。即有强烈自我表达的心理倾向,不羞口,不胆怯。心理学家古朗说:“被要求讲一种外国语言,不仅仅是心理上受威胁,精神与身体的整个系统都直接受到牵连。”所以,培养“说”的这种素质,要循序渐进。所以本课题提出“提高学生英语言语技能”激发学生讲英语的兴趣,培养“说”的能力,达到提高学生交际能力。

sql语言的ddl实验报告范文

sql语言的ddl实验报告范文怎么写?下面我们九月范文网实验报告频道给大家精编的7篇关于sql语言的ddl实验报告范文,希望对大家有所帮助,内容仅供参考!

下载全文 收藏